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[PHP]Jak nazywa się punkcja w PHP która odświeza plik konieczności otwierania go?
zbychu1985
post 14.03.2020, 05:22:51
Post #1





Grupa: Zarejestrowani
Postów: 24
Pomógł: 0
Dołączył: 26.01.2020

Ostrzeżenie: (0%)
-----


Krótki pytanie, szukałem tego ale nic nie mogę znaleść, być może zle zadaje pytanie.

Jak nazywa się punkcja w PHP która odświeża plik konieczności otwierania go?

Próbowałem z header("Refresh:0; url=page2.php");
ale ta funkcja przenosi na page2.php co jest dla mnie nieporządne.

Go to the top of the page
+Quote Post
viking
post 14.03.2020, 07:22:20
Post #2





Grupa: Zarejestrowani
Postów: 6 365
Pomógł: 1114
Dołączył: 30.08.2006

Ostrzeżenie: (0%)
-----


PHP działa po stronie SERWERA. Raz wygenerowanego kodu nie odświeżysz ponownie. Pewnie chcesz to zrobić w JS.


--------------------
Go to the top of the page
+Quote Post
kreatiff
post 15.03.2020, 09:46:26
Post #3





Grupa: Zarejestrowani
Postów: 324
Pomógł: 105
Dołączył: 7.08.2012

Ostrzeżenie: (0%)
-----


Może chodzi Ci o proste odświeżanie strony co X sekund za pomocą meta refresh?
  1. <meta http-equiv="refresh" content="5">
Ale to nie ma związku z PHP.
Go to the top of the page
+Quote Post
Pyton_000
post 15.03.2020, 11:27:08
Post #4





Grupa: Zarejestrowani
Postów: 8 068
Pomógł: 1414
Dołączył: 26.10.2005

Ostrzeżenie: (0%)
-----


Domyślam się że chcesz wchodząc na stronę odpalić inny skrypt.

Możesz spróbować

file_get_contents('http://twojastrona.pl/skrypt2.php');

To spowoduje wywołanie innego adresu. bez ingerencji w aktualny request.
Jesli nie zadziała to trzeba użyć curla w php.

Go to the top of the page
+Quote Post
zbychu1985
post 15.03.2020, 14:53:51
Post #5





Grupa: Zarejestrowani
Postów: 24
Pomógł: 0
Dołączył: 26.01.2020

Ostrzeżenie: (0%)
-----


Pyton_00 dokładnie o to mi chodzi, logująć się lub wchodząc na strone odpalić inny skrypt,
niestety ta funkcja mi dziła, robie to tak:
file_get_contents('../../php/3_calender.php');

próbowałem też tak:
file_get_contents('localhost/ver5/php/3_calender.php');

pytanie czy tak moge to zapisać czy musi być prze http?



Go to the top of the page
+Quote Post
Pyton_000
post 16.03.2020, 13:51:05
Post #6





Grupa: Zarejestrowani
Postów: 8 068
Pomógł: 1414
Dołączył: 26.10.2005

Ostrzeżenie: (0%)
-----


Musi to być adres pełny adres który jest dost. z przeglądarki.

Albo można jeszcze inaczel ale podkreślam że to jest NIEBEZPIECZNE oraz MOCNO nie zaleca się używania:

Kod
eval(file_get_contents('../../php/3_calender.php'));

Powinno też zadziałać ale jest to bardzo niebezpieczne.
Go to the top of the page
+Quote Post
zbychu1985
post 16.03.2020, 23:51:41
Post #7





Grupa: Zarejestrowani
Postów: 24
Pomógł: 0
Dołączył: 26.01.2020

Ostrzeżenie: (0%)
-----


Ale co to znaczy bardzo niebezpieczne? Spale serwer czy odrazu całą serwerownie?

Go to the top of the page
+Quote Post
nospor
post 17.03.2020, 08:48:46
Post #8





Grupa: Moderatorzy
Postów: 36 455
Pomógł: 6292
Dołączył: 27.12.2004




eval(file_get_contents('../../php/3_calender.php'));
yyy......., INCLUDE panowie to jest chyba to o co Wam chodzi wink.gif


--------------------

"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ista
"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er

Go to the top of the page
+Quote Post
Pyton_000
post 17.03.2020, 09:54:05
Post #9





Grupa: Zarejestrowani
Postów: 8 068
Pomógł: 1414
Dołączył: 26.10.2005

Ostrzeżenie: (0%)
-----


Cytat(nospor @ 17.03.2020, 08:48:46 ) *
eval(file_get_contents('../../php/3_calender.php'));
yyy......., INCLUDE panowie to jest chyba to o co Wam chodzi wink.gif

I take I nice. Include może mieć negatywny wpływ na obecną zawartośc uruchamianego pliku np. nadpisując jakieś zmienne. No chyba że można odpalić na samym końcu pliku wtedy nie ma problemu.

Cytat
Ale co to znaczy bardzo niebezpieczne? Spale serwer czy odrazu całą serwerownie?

Zobacz sobie w dokumentacji co robi funkcja eval

Ten post edytował Pyton_000 17.03.2020, 09:54:41
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 25.04.2024 - 13:28